So this past Halloween was memorable as well...and in a good way! I gathered a group of friends to go to Pierce College's Halloween Harvest and Fright Fair. For $25, we were able to do the regular corn maze, Creatures of the Corn (maze), and the Factory of Nightmares. The $25 included admission to the rest of grounds with ubiquitous attractions such as a pumpkin patch, petting zoo, food stands, games, and giant slides/moonbouncers etc. Jerry and I might turn it into an annual thing, we had such a good time!
